Description
2-(2H-Tetrazol-5-Yl)-Phenylboronic Acid is a specialized boronic acid derivative that serves as a critical building block in modern synthetic chemistry. Its unique structure, combining a tetrazole heterocycle with a phenylboronic acid moiety, makes it an invaluable reagent for constructing complex molecular architectures, particularly in pharmaceutical research. This compound is primarily sought by R&D chemists and process development scientists in the pharmaceutical, agrochemical, and advanced materials sectors for applications in cross-coupling reactions and as a precursor for active pharmaceutical ingredients (APIs).
Application
- Pharmaceutical Intermediate: A key precursor in the synthesis of active pharmaceutical ingredients (APIs), especially for drugs targeting cardiovascular and central nervous system diseases.
- Suzuki-Miyaura Cross-Coupling: Serves as a versatile boronic acid coupling partner for constructing biaryl and heterobiaryl systems, which are common scaffolds in medicinal chemistry.
- Agrochemical Research: Used in the development of novel herbicides, fungicides, and insecticides, leveraging the bioactivity of the tetrazole ring.
- Material Science: Employed in the synthesis of organic electronic materials, such as those used in OLEDs and organic photovoltaics, due to its conjugated system.
- Chemical Biology & Proteomics: Acts as a handle for bioconjugation and labeling strategies, exploiting the boronic acid group's affinity for diols.
- Library Synthesis for Drug Discovery: Facilitates the rapid generation of diverse compound libraries for high-throughput screening in hit identification and lead optimization.
Basic Information
| Product Name | 2-(2H-Tetrazol-5-Yl)-Phenylboronic Acid |
| CAS No. | 155884-01-8 |
| Molecular Formula | C8H7BN4O2 |
| Molecular Weight | 202.98 g/mol |
| Synonyms | [2-(2H-Tetrazol-5-yl)phenyl]boronic acid; 2-(1H-Tetrazol-5-yl)benzeneboronic acid; 2-(2H-Tetrazol-5-yl)benzeneboronic acid; 2-(Tetrazol-5-yl)phenylboronic acid; 5-(2-Boronophenyl)-1H-tetrazole; 2-(1H-Tetrazol-5-yl)phenylboronic Acid; 2-(2H-1,2,3,4-Tetrazol-5-yl)phenylboronic acid; B-[2-(2H-Tetrazol-5-yl)phenyl]boronic acid |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(15-25°C). Due to its hygroscopic (moisture-sensitive) nature, the container must be kept tightly sealed under an inert atmosphere (e.g., nitrogen or argon) after opening to prevent degradation. Keep away from incompatible materials.
